Effects of Trifoliumpratense Leguminosae extract on mouse allogenetic skin transplantation / 中华中医药杂志

ABSTRACT

Objective:

To observe the effect of Trifoliumpratense Leguminosae extract (TLE) on mouse allogenetic skin transplantation.

Methods:

Recipient BALB/c was divided into physiologic saline (PS) group and TLE group, full-thickness skins were transplanted through back to back method from donor C57BL/6. The allogenetic transplanted skin growth condition was observed. The proliferation of lymphocytes of recipient mice in vitro were detected by CFDA-SE stain and mixed lymphocyte reaction respectively.

Results:

The allogenetic transplanted skin injected with TLE 25g/kg per day by vena caudalis growed better than that in PS group. The proliferation of lymphocyte in TLE group was smaller than that in PS group.

Conclusion:

TLE maybe participate in the regulation of mouse immune system and induce its tolerance to the allogenetic transplanted skin.
